What they do

A Religious Leader or Professional leads religious services and provides spiritual guidance or counseling. Presents knowledge and interpretation of theological texts. May work in a non-denominational setting like a prison or hospital, or work for specific faith-based congregation or denomination and follow the practices of that faith.

Job Description

Westchester EFC Corporate Worship Ministry Director The primary responsibility of this position is to lead a team of volunteers who will lead the congregation in worship while emphasizing what is Biblically true and Gospel-centered in the lyrics we sing while stirring our affection, awe, and adoration of God. Through music, lead us in awe-filled praise to God for all He is and all He has done. Key Responsibilities Worship Leadership Implement a vision of worship that upholds what is biblically true of God while helping us center on the Gospel and express our affection and adoration of God. Lead the Worship Ministry team-planners, musicians, and AV personnel-in coordinating song selection, service planning, and overall ministry operations. Coordinate the music planning and teams for various special services (Christmas Eve, Good Friday, Global Conference, funerals ). Oversee the Worship Ministry Budget. Team Development Lead a team of planners to prepare weekly worship services in partnership with the Lead Pastor. Recruit, mentor, and coordinate volunteer worship leaders, musicians, and tech team members to grow and maintain a strong team culture. Provide clear onramps into worship ministry for new people to join and use their talents to glorify God. Evaluate and utilize the individual skillsets of the team in a complimentary fashion. Facilitate rehearsals, schedule teams, and foster a healthy, unified ministry culture. Provide real time feedback in rehearsals to improve quality and energy while building confidence. Administration & Support Utilize tools like Planning Center for scheduling and service planning. Develop and maintain a working knowledge of AV equipment, both what we use in house and streaming. Collaborate with the AV team to ensure smooth worship production and sound quality. Oversee worship resources, equipment, and budget. Qualifications A mature, growing relationship with Jesus Christ In agreement with the EFCA Statement of Faith. An enthusiastic member of Westchester, or willing to become one. Experience with leading and developing people. Skilled in leading worship vocally and instrumentally (guitar and/or keyboard preferred). Experience leading blended worship in a church setting; comfortable working with multigenerational teams. Strong organizational, communication, and leadership skills. Committed to personally growing in both personal walk with Christ and professional skill. A humble awareness of growth areas.
